New CWD Cases Discovered at Captive Deer Breeding Facilities

AUSTIN – Two new cases of chronic wasting disease (CWD) in Texas captive deer, including the first confirmed from a live test tonsillar biopsy sample, have been validated. The Texas Parks and Wildlife Department (TPWD) and Texas Animal Health Commission (TAHC) are conducting an epidemiological investigation into these new cases.

Commission Approves Changes to Deer Hunting Regulations for 2016-17

AUSTIN – The Texas Parks and Wildlife Commission adopted a suite of changes to this year’s deer hunting regulations that includes expanding white-tailed deer hunting into 14 counties across the western Panhandle, and creating additional deer hunting opportunities in East Texas.

Partners Continue Mule Deer Restoration Effort in the Big Bend

ALPINE— In a continued effort to boost a struggling mule deer population in parts of the Big Bend region of far West Texas, 75 female mule deer were recently relocated from Elephant Mountain Wildlife Management Area (WMA) and two private ranches in Brewster County to the Black Gap Wildlife WMA and adjacent El Carmen Land & Conservation Company (ECLCC) – CEMEX USA and Cuenca Los Ojos property.

Hartley County Mule Deer Tests Positive for Chronic Wasting Disease

AUSTIN – A free-ranging mule deer buck, harvested in Hartley County, has been confirmed positive for CWD. State officials received confirmation today from the National Veterinary Services Laboratory (NVSL) in Ames, Iowa.
